Cedars of Lebanon Nursing Center
Detailed report on the nursing home located in Lebanon, Kentucky (KY).
Cedars of Lebanon Nursing Center is an average sized, for-profit, nursing home with 81 beds based at 337 South Harrison Street in Lebanon, KY. The facility has 81 residents indicating 100% of its beds are occupied, which is above average within this state. The provider participates in the medicare & medicaid programs and provides resident counseling services. The home is not located in a hospital or continuing care retirement community and is fully sprinklered. A total of 49 Medicare patients were given 2,417 days of non-swing bed care and services in 2006, and the provider was reimbursed $543,799 by Medicare. 73 Medicare patients were given outpatient care and services by this provider in 2006. The provider was reimbursed $108,840 by Medicare for these services.
On a state level, the number of registered nurse hours per resident per day is average. Certified nursing assistant hours per resident per day is lower than average. The number of licensed practical or vocational nurse hours per resident per day is lower than average. Licensed staff hours per resident per day is lower than average.
When compared to other nursing homes in the state, it is more likely for long-stay residents to be more depressed or anxious, low-risk long-stay residents to lose control of their bowels, long-stay residents to have a urinary tract infection, and short-stay residents to have delirium at Cedars of Lebanon Nursing Center.
When compared to other nursing homes in the state, it is less likely for long-stay residents to need help with daily activities to increase, long-stay residents to be physically restrained, long-stay residents to have catheter inserted and left, long-stay residents to spend most of their time in bed, long-stay residents to have their ability to move around their room get worse, and short-stay residents to have moderate to severe pain.
